Sri Lanka parliament approves bill to boost central bank independence

Sri Lanka’s parliament on Thursday (July 20) approved a new law to improve the independence of the country’s central bank, the deputy speaker said, as part of reforms linked to a $2.9 billion International Monetary Fund bailout package.

European Commission proposes 4-year extension to GSP+

The European Commission (EU) has proposed a four-year extension to the current GSP+ scheme until 31 Dec 2027, so that countries, such as Sri Lanka, do not lose their preferential access in the interim.

Sakvithi Ranasinghe and his wife plead guilty in High Court

Sakvithi Ranasinghe and his wife today (July 19) pleaded guilty to committing financial fraud by misusing its deposits worth over Rs. 1,628 million obtained from the public while maintaining the Sakvithi Housing and Construction (Pvt.) Ltd in Nugegoda.
